logo

PHPMyAdmin Girişi

giriiş

phpMyAdmin belirtilen özgür yazılım aracıdır PHP , web üzerinde MySQL yönetimini yönetmek için tasarlanmıştır. Bu yazılım aracı çok geniş bir işlem aralığını destekler. MariaDB Ve MySQL . En çok kullanılan işlemler izinler, kullanıcılar, indeksler, ilişkiler, sütunlar, tablolar, veritabanlarının yönetimi vb.'dir. Bir kullanıcı arayüzü ile uygulanabilir. Yine de SQL deyimini doğrudan çalıştırma olanağımız var.

Arraylist'i sırala

phpMyAdmin Çok geniş bir dokümantasyon yelpazesi kullanır ve kullanıcılar wiki sayfalarını güncelleyebilecek ve çeşitli işlemlere ilişkin fikirleri dağıtabilecektir. Herhangi bir sorunla karşılaştığımızda bize destek olacaktır. Destek almak için destek kanalının çeşitliliğini uygulayabiliriz.

Ayrıca, phpMyAdmin geliştiriciler tarafından açıklanan bir kitapta çok iyi bir şekilde belgelenmiştir. Etkili MySQL Yönetimi için phpMyAdmin'de Uzmanlaşmak , uygun İspanyol Ve İngilizce .

Anahtar noktaları:

    phpMyAdmin hem RTL hem de LTR dillerini destekler ve dönüştürülür 72 Diller . phpMyAdmin Esnek ve istikrarlı kod tabanıyla birlikte en yaygın kullanılan olgun projelerden biridir. Tarihçesi, projesi ve topladığı ödüller hakkında daha fazlasını bulabiliriz.
  • Bu proje Yazılım Özgürlüğünü Koruma üyesidir. Yazılım Özgürlüğünü Koruma, açık kaynaklı Yazılımları, Libre'yi iyileştirmeyi, tanıtmayı, geliştirmeyi ve ücretsiz projeleri savunmayı destekleyen, kar amacı gütmeyen bir kuruluştur.

PhpMyAdmin'in özellikleri:

PHPMyAdmin Girişi
  • Verileri SQL ve CSV aracılığıyla içe aktarın
  • Sezgisel web arayüzü
  • MySQL yönleri için destek:
    • Veritabanlarını, dizinleri, alanları, görünümleri ve tabloları bırakın ve bunlara göz atın.
    • Veritabanlarını, dizinleri, alanları ve tabloları değiştirin, yeniden adlandırın, bırakın, kopyalayın ve oluşturun.
    • Sunucudaki tekliflerle tabloları, veritabanlarını ve sunucuyu koruyun
    • Toplu sorguları ve SQL deyimini yer imlerine ekleyin, düzenleyin ve yürütün.
    • MySQL ayrıcalıklarını ve kullanıcı hesaplarını yönetin.
    • Saklanan tetikleyicileri ve prosedürleri yönetin.
  • Çeşitli formatlara ilişkin verileri dışa aktarın: PDF, XML, SQL, JEC/JSO, CSV .
  • Veritabanı düzenimizin grafiklerini çeşitli formatlarda tasarlamak.
  • Çoklu sunucular.
  • QBE (örneğe göre sorgulama) ile karmaşık sorgular yapma.
  • Saklanan verileri, BLOB verilerinin indirme bağlantısı veya resim olarak gösterilmesi gibi önceden tanımlanmış işlevler kümesine sahip bir formata dönüştürme.
  • Veritabanında veya herhangi bir alt kümesinde genel olarak arama yapmak.

phpMyAdmin Bağlantısı

Çeşitli güvenlik nedenleriyle 127.0.0.1 ana makine adı kullanıldığında phpMyAdmin'e erişilebilir. Uzak sistem üzerinden erişim sağlamak için istekleri 127.0.0.1 üzerinden herhangi bir Web sunucusuna yönlendiren SSH tünelini yapmalıyız. Uygulamalara uzaktan erişebilmek için SSH üzerindeki sunucumuza bağlanabilmemiz gerektiğini belirtir.

Not: Aşağıdaki adımlara geçmeden önce veritabanı sunucumuzun ve Web'in çalıştığından emin olun.

PhpMyAdmin'e SSH tüneli üzerinden erişmek için SSH istemcisine ihtiyacımız var. Aşağıdaki talimatların içinde PuTTY'yi seçtik. PuTTY, LINUX ve Windows platformları için SSH istemcisidir (ücretsiz). İlk adım PuTTY yapılandırmasıdır.

SSH istemcimizi doğru şekilde yapılandırdıktan ve örneğimize SSH ile başarılı bir şekilde erişebildiğimizi doğruladıktan sonra, phpMyAdmin'e erişim için SSH tüneli oluşturmamız gerekir. Aşağıdaki adımları göz önünde bulundurun:

  • 'Bağlantı -> SSH -> Tüneller' bölümüne aşağıdaki değerleri girerek yeni bağlantı noktasını ekleyin:
    • Kaynak Bağlantı Noktası: 8888
    • Hedef: localhost:80

Not: HTTP isteklerini bir HTTP bağlantı noktasına yönlendiriyorsak, 80 yerine 443 numaralı bağlantı noktasını dikkate almalıyız.

Yerel ana bilgisayardaki (localhost veya 127.0.0.1) herhangi bir bağlantı noktası için bağlantı noktasını uzak bir sunucu üzerinden ileterek korumalı bir tünel oluşturacaktır.

  • Korumalı tünel yapılandırmasını herhangi bir oturuma eklemek için düğmeye, yani 'Ekle'ye basın. 'İletilen bağlantı noktaları' listesinde eklenmiş bir bağlantı noktası göreceğiz.
  • 'Oturum' bölümündeki 'Kaydet' tuşuna basarak değişikliklerimizi kaydedin.
  • Bir sunucunun SSH oturumunu açmak için düğmeye, yani 'Aç'a basın. Bu SSH oturumu, açıklanan iki bağlantı noktası arasına korumalı bir tünel ekleyecektir.
  • http://127.0.0.1:8888/phpmyadmin adresine göz atarak oluşturduğumuz korumalı tünelden phpMyAdmin konsoluna erişin.
  • Şimdi aşağıdaki bilgileri kullanarak phpMyAdmin'e giriş yapın:
    • Kullanıcı adı: root
    • Şifre: uygulama şifresi

PhpMyAdmin'e MacOS ve Linux üzerinden erişin

Web tarayıcımıza dava açan bir uygulamaya erişmek için SSH tünelini aşağıda belirtildiği gibi yapın:

  • Yerel sistemimizde terminal penceresini (yeni) açın (Ubuntu veya MacOS içindeki Dash'ta, 'Finder -> Uygulamalar -> Yardımcı Programlar -> Terminal'i kullanarak).
  • SSH kimlik bilgilerimizin (.pem anahtar dosyası olarak da bilinir) elimizde olduğundan emin olun.
  • SSH'nin anahtar dosyasını kullanarak bir SSH tüneli yapılandırmak için aşağıdaki komutu yürütün. SERVER-IP'mize ve özel anahtarımıza giden yolu kullanarak KEYFILE'ı sunucumuzun ana bilgisayar adı veya IP adresi (genel) ile değiştirmeyi unutmayın:
 ssh -N -L 8888:127.0.0.1:80 -ⅰKEYFILE bitnami@SERVER-IP 
  • SSH şifresini kullanarak SSH tüneli yapılandırmak için aşağıdaki komutu uygulayın. Sunucumuzun ana bilgisayar adını veya IP adresini (genel) kullanarak SUNUCU-IP'yi değiştirmemiz gerekir. İstendiğinde SSH şifresini girin.
 ssh -N -L 8888:127.0.0.1:80 KEYFILE bitnami@SERVER-IP 

Not: Komut SSH tünelini oluşturacaktır. Ancak sunucu konsolu üzerinden herhangi bir sonuç gösterilmeyecektir.

  • Oluşturduğumuz korumalı tünelden hhtp://127.0.0.1:8888/phpmyadmin adresine göz atarak phpMyAdmin konsoluna erişin.
  • Şimdi aşağıdaki bilgileri kullanarak phpMyAdmin'e giriş yapın:
    • Kullanıcı adı: root
    • Şifre: uygulama şifresi